Trying to test out the full order item to completed catalog process. I have a simple test with a few steps.
Search Catalog
Open Item
Set values
Order Item
Query the Record
This ends with the REQ displaying on the screen. Our approvals are on the requested item. When you use the query record, there doesn't seem to be a way to get to the requested item to approve it. The only options are Cart or Request. How do you drill into Requested Item?

Hello Tony,
To get into the approvals, they are on another table called 'sysapproval_approver'.
Query the related approval with the number of your generated request and manually approve it in a script. This will allow it to continue in your process.
